Buying Guide

  • Compatibility: Verify that your camera cage, monitor arm, or tripod supports 1/4″-20 threads and has room for a cold shoe mount. Some cages require specific mounting plates or adapters.
  • Mounting stability: Consider mounts with multiple attachment points or screws (e.g., two M2.5 screws) to reduce wobble and prevent accessory slippage during movement.
  • Port count and layout: For multi-device setups, choose a three-port or dual-mount solution to keep cords clean and devices organized.
  • Weight and balance: Lighter mounts help preserve rig balance, especially when using lightweight cameras or handheld rigs. Ensure the added weight does not exceed rig capacity.
  • Material and durability: Aluminum alloy builds provide strong, wear-resistant performance in varying environments; avoid plastic-only designs if you plan to use heavier gear.
  • Accessibility: Ensure the mount does not obstruct essential controls or screen visibility; consider ball-head variants for adjustable angles.
  • Installation complexity: Simple two-screw designs are quick to install, while triple-port or ball-head options may require additional setup time but offer greater versatility.
  • Compatibility with existing gear: If you already own SmallRig cages or other brands, confirm cross-compatibility to maximize value.

In practice, a dual-pack or triple-port design is ideal for creators who frequently add or swap accessories. For tight spaces, a slim adapter that attaches to a cage or plate can free up rail space while maintaining solid attachment. Always verify that the chosen mount can securely grip your devices and that the 1/4″-20 thread aligns with your accessory’s screw requirement.
